company background image
ECHA logo

Ecopetrol DB:ECHA Stock Report

Last Price

€8.20

Market Cap

€16.8b

7D

-1.7%

1Y

-30.5%

Updated

22 Sep, 2024

Data

Company Financials +

Ecopetrol S.A. Competitors

Price History & Performance

Summary of all time highs, changes and price drops for Ecopetrol
Historical stock prices
Current Share PriceCol$8.20
52 Week HighCol$12.30
52 Week LowCol$7.92
Beta0.72
11 Month Change-11.64%
3 Month Change-29.31%
1 Year Change-30.51%
33 Year Change-28.07%
5 Year Change-47.60%
Change since IPO-54.42%

Recent News & Updates

Recent updates

Shareholder Returns

ECHADE Oil and GasDE Market
7D-1.7%-0.8%-0.008%
1Y-30.5%-41.8%6.8%

Return vs Industry: ECHA exceeded the German Oil and Gas industry which returned -41.8% over the past year.

Return vs Market: ECHA underperformed the German Market which returned 6.8% over the past year.

Price Volatility

Is ECHA's price volatile compared to industry and market?
ECHA volatility
ECHA Average Weekly Movement5.2%
Oil and Gas Industry Average Movement6.3%
Market Average Movement4.9%
10% most volatile stocks in DE Market11.9%
10% least volatile stocks in DE Market2.4%

Stable Share Price: ECHA's share price has been volatile over the past 3 months.

Volatility Over Time: ECHA's weekly volatility (5%) has been stable over the past year.

About the Company

FoundedEmployeesCEOWebsite
194818,903Ricardo Barraganwww.ecopetrol.com.co

Ecopetrol S.A. operates as an integrated energy company. The company operates through four segments: Exploration and Production; Transport and Logistics; Refining, Petrochemical and Biofuels; and Electric Power Transmission and Toll Roads Concessions. It engages in the exploration and production of oil and gas; transportation of crude oil, motor fuels, fuel oil, and other refined products, including diesel, jet, and biofuels; processing and refining crude oil; distribution of natural gas and LPG; sale of refined and petrochemical products; supplying of electric power transmission services; design, development, construction, operation, and maintenance of road and energy infrastructure projects; and supplying of information technology and telecommunications services.

Ecopetrol S.A. Fundamentals Summary

How do Ecopetrol's earnings and revenue compare to its market cap?
ECHA fundamental statistics
Market cap€16.76b
Earnings (TTM)€3.60b
Revenue (TTM)€28.87b

4.7x

P/E Ratio

0.6x

P/S Ratio

Earnings & Revenue

Key profitability statistics from the latest earnings report (TTM)
ECHA income statement (TTM)
RevenueCol$133.85t
Cost of RevenueCol$82.62t
Gross ProfitCol$51.23t
Other ExpensesCol$34.53t
EarningsCol$16.70t

Last Reported Earnings

Jun 30, 2024

Next Earnings Date

n/a

Earnings per share (EPS)406.20
Gross Margin38.27%
Net Profit Margin12.48%
Debt/Equity Ratio115.0%

How did ECHA perform over the long term?

See historical performance and comparison

Dividends

16.5%

Current Dividend Yield

68%

Payout Ratio